In loving memory of Karl Christopher Moyes who sadly passed away on 17th September 2017. Karl was an amazing husband, father, son, brother and friend. He will be hugely missed by everyone who had the great privilege of knowing him and being a part of his life. In true Karl style, he bore his horrible illness with great strength and determination, never once complaining. He will be forever in our hearts.
